Replacement pads for nerf bars

I was hoping that one of you folks could help me find where to purchase replacement plastic step pads for my Reese nerf bars. I have an 06 F-250 with 3" nerf bars and one plastic step is cracked. I've been to the Reese web site and searched the web but cant seem to find just the pads. I will take new or used so any help is greatly appreciated. Thanks

I believe some brands have lifetime warranties on their step pads so you shouldn't have to buy a new set of bars. But I suppose it just depends on the brand. ICI has the warranty and all you have to do it go on their website and request a new set for free, all you have to pay is for shipping which was about $8 when I ordered a replacement set for my wife's truck.
